It's not a printer at all but there's no category for a stand alone scanner!  Is there any way of turning off the automatic numbering of scanned documents please?  We can enter a name for a document but when it comes up on the screen, numbers have been added to the end so we always have to go back into the document and delete them.

 

Specifically, we normally scan documents which may be several pages long but which we keep as a single multi-page document.

Thanks for such a speedy and helpful reply.  We are using HP software downloaded when we installed the Scanjet Pro.  When we scan a document and go to save it, the default 'name' which comes up is shown as Scan_{n}.pdf.  We always completely blank that name and type in the name we want.  However, do you think that it could it be this {n} which is triggering the autonumbering?

 

We find it puzzling because we always remove it by putting in the name we want.  We'll do another software update but it looks as though we may have to live with it.  We do have two other printers - both HP - which have scanners but this little Scanjet Pro is brilliant.

Thank you so much for your guidance.  I went through to the Destination - File type and found that the scans were defaulting to Scan_{n}.pdf.  I then found a click box which was by default set to document counter.  When I turned it off, the scans then defaulted to Scan.pdf.
